Cons

Stock Cooperative Ownership Structure: The property is a stock cooperative, which typically involves a different ownership model than traditional condominiums, potentially leading to unique financing challenges, stricter rules, and a smaller buyer pool.
High Monthly Association Fee: The association fee of $1108 per month is substantial, adding a significant ongoing cost to homeownership and potentially impacting overall affordability for buyers.
